CJR Program Moderately Decreased Spending Without Increasing Complications
January 4th 2019Hospitals that are participating in Medicare’s mandatory bundled payment model for hip and knee replacements reported a decrease in spending per episode of $812 compared with control hospitals not participating in the Comprehensive Care for Joint Replacement (CJR) program.

HRRP May Have Done More Harm for Patients With Heart Failure and Pneumonia
December 28th 2018The Hospital Readmission Reduction Program was announced as part of the Affordable Care Act and penalized hospitals for higher-than-expected 30-day readmissions. However, new research finds that the policy may have done more harm than good with postdischarge mortality increasing for Medicare beneficiaries hospitalized for heart failure and pneumonia.

CMS Finalizes Overhaul of MSSP With Some Changes to Its Proposed Rule
December 22nd 2018CMS has finalized “Pathways to Success,” its overhaul of the Medicare Shared Savings Program (MSSP) that will push accountable care organizations to assume risk more quickly. The final rule includes some changes to the proposed rule, which was introduced in August.

Majority of Hospitals Will Receive Incentive Payments in 2019 Hospital VBP Program
December 4th 2018In fiscal year 2019, there will be approximately $1.9 billion in value-based incentive payments available to hospitals in the Hospital Value-Based Purchasing (VBP) Program, which is a budget-neutral program.

CMS Finalizes New Structure to Move Home Health to Value-Based Payment
November 28th 2018CMS is moving home health agencies away from a volume-based payment model and to a new value-based payment system. The Patient-Driven Groupings Model would focus on patient needs and rely more heavily on patient characteristics in order to pay for home health services.
